Falta poco para que la sala de lectura cierre por hoy, todo el gran museo cerrará. Los domingos la sala de lectura no abre; entre hoy y el próximo sábado, la lectura será cuestión de una hora robada aquí y allá al final del día. ¿Debería seguir al pie del cañón hasta la hora de cierre aunque bostece sin parar? De todos modos, ¿Qué sentido tiene su empeño? ¿En qué beneficia a un programador informático, si es que la programación va a ser su vida, tener un master en literatura inglesa? "Juventud" (2002), J. M. Coetzee
"Juventud" (2002) Frases de "Juventud" (2002) Frases de J. M. Coetzee
Las habilidades que marcan la diferencia en el ámbito de la programación informática no son estrictamente técnicas sino que tienen que ver con la capacidad de trabajar en equipo. En este sentido, los mejores siempre están dispuestos, por ejemplo, a quedarse un tiempo extra para ayudar a sus compañeros a concluir un proyecto y no se guardan para sí los pequeños descubrimientos que pueden facilitar el trabajo sino que los comparten abiertamente. Son personas, en suma, que no compiten sino que colaboran. "La práctica de la inteligencia emocional" (1998), Daniel Goleman
Frases de "La práctica de la inteligencia emocional" (1998) Frases de Daniel Goleman
¿Sabe usted qué es lo que me recuerda su persona? Pues un computador. Se está usted programando a sí mismo. "Las manzanas" (1969), Agatha Christie
"Las manzanas" (1969) Frases de "Las manzanas" (1969) Frases de Agatha Christie
Los bancos no pueden cambiar sus claves todos los días... Debe de existir un programa en el sistema que descifre todas las claves y que, de alguna manera, determine su validez aunque cambien sin previo aviso. "Riesgo calculado" (1992), Katherine Neville
"Riesgo calculado" (1992) Frases de "Riesgo calculado" (1992) Frases de Katherine Neville
La experiencia demuestra que el éxito de un curso de programación depende críticamente de la elección de los ejemplos que se utilice.
La actividad creativa de la programación, que se distingue de la codificación, se enseña generalmente por medio de ejemplos que sirven para exhibir ciertas técnicas.
Un lenguaje de programación representa un computador abstracto capaz de entender los términos utilizados en ese lenguaje, que pueden ser más abstractos que los de los objetos utilizados por la máquina real.
¿Qué sentido tiene tratar de enseñar algo a alguien? Esa pregunta pareció suscitar un murmullo de simpática aprobación a todo lo largo de la mesa. -Lo que quiero decir es que si de verdad se quiere entender algo -continuó Richard-, lo mejor es tratar de explicárselo a otro. Eso obliga a ordenar las ideas. Y cuanto más lento y torpe sea el alumno, más se tendrá que reducir el tema a ideas cada vez más simples. Y ése es el verdadero fundamento de la programación. Cuando una idea se estructura paso a paso de tal modo que hasta una estúpida máquina llega a comprenderla, uno ya ha aprendido algo de la misma. "Dirk Gently: Agencia de Investigaciones Holísticas" (1987), Douglas Adams
"Dirk Gently: Agencia de Investigaciones Holísticas" (1987) Frases de "Dirk Gently: Agencia de Investigaciones Holísticas" (1987) Frases de Douglas Adams
Ha puesto verdadero interés en la tecnología, te lo aseguro. Por otra parte, allí también hacen mucha programación. Ya sabes, ciclos iterativos para perfeccionar el proceso de fabricación. Asentí con la cabeza. - ¿Qué clase de programación? -pregunté. -Procesamiento distribuido. Redes multiagente. Así mantenemos coordinadas las unidades independientes, para que funcionen de manera conjunta.
Te voy a revelar un secreto profesional: puedes exorcizar todos esos fantasmas semióticos con la peor programación. Si a mí me quita de encima a los fanáticos de los ovnis, a ti te puede liberar de esos futuroides modernistas. Inténtalo. "Quemando cromo" (1986), William Gibson
Si la depuración es el proceso de eliminar errores, entonces la programación debe ser el proceso de introducirlos.
El gran cambio en los lenguajes de programación vino cuando empezamos a dar definiciones formales a la semántica de los conceptos de los lenguajes de programación. Algo que hace falta si se quieren probar cosas sobre los programas escritos en él. Y aún si no se espera conseguirlo de una manera formal, es un ejercicio extremadamente saludable para los diseñadores de lenguajes de programación. La formalización actuó como un sistema de alerta temprana: si la definición formal de una característica se vuelve confusa y complicada, entonces no se debe ignorar esa advertencia.